Post 1646 GTB, 25 GTR reveiw.
MM Brand:Gator-Tail
Horsepower:25 EFI Subaru, 32" outdrive, tall transom
Boat Brand:Gator-Tail
Boat Size:16 X 46, Hunt deck, bow rails, receiver hitch, spud poles, Gator grass camo, hydro turff
Boat Layout: Completly open, nothing is permantly mounted
Add ons: 22" dual row LED light & Duallys, Super Terra 3500lbs winch mounted to Gator-Tail receiver setup, Minn Kota salt water trolling motor( transom mount with adapter to bow for easy removal), Removable Gun box, auxillary battery in the front for trolling motor.

Speeds | Shallow Water: 27 mph (bumping 28) 10"-18" water
Speeds | Deep Water:23-24 Intercoastal Waterway
Total Boat Load With Gear Etc:Me(225) Passenger(250) gun box, guns, 6 gallons fuel, Full K2, safety gear
Conditions Tested In: north wind 8-10 mph, 45* slight chop in the deep water, fairly calm in the shallows

It goes with saying this is a 25 hp motor and a 16' boat, the cut off for me was 3 people in deep water.

Comments: First, sorry for the review taking so long, many had asked about it but I didn't want to give a review until I had plenty of experience with the boat.

I have had this boat since the beginning of May. I feel I got exactly what I wanted and the process went very well. I was quoted 8 weeks to build and it was just that to the day. Justin ( Take em Gator) was very helpful as a Pro-staffer and Bubba was very cool, even when I wanted pictures all the time. Justin guided me in the right direction for what I wanted.

I do everything out of this boat, albeit I'm not much for offshore or big open water. This boat fulfills all my boat needs, from gigging, to stalking reds, to duck hunts.

One other thing I feel needs to be said is there was a period where I asked the forum a lot of questions regarding engine stuff and speeds of other similar boats. Well if you notice the speeds above you will see i'm right where most are. I credit this to the engine not being broken in and equally to an inexperienced driver. By that I mean it took me a while to actually get in some shallow stuff where this boat shines. I must also say that Mr. Broussard called me a few months back inquiring as to what could cause me to not be getting higher speeds and even offered possible solutions. I cant say it enough how nice it was to hear someone a few months after getting the boat trying to ensure I was happy with my purchase from them.

We need some mods for these 25's. .... i want a cam!!!! My 25 falls off a lot with 3 in deep water... no problem in shallow water with 3.....Cam and programmer is what I am hoping for in the coming year.


Great review.... i had a 36 pd before getting the 25 gtr..... i do miss the torque of the big block.....The 25 does get weak with a 3 person and gear load....... but runs perfectly with 2 and gear....

Cajun, flipping the boat wasn't too bad. It took three guys, it was harder flipping it back upright. If you just want the bunks slick look into poly covers for the. 2x4's. Though Gatorglide is for sure a worth while investment .

I can push my boat off the trailer on level ground with one hand. I'm stuck on the couch with a torn ligament in my ankle, when I get released I'll get some footage of how I load unload the boat with the GG.
